There are plenty of spots in the Bay State to immerse yourself in nature on a camping trip. However, Nickerson State Park in Brewster might just be the most massive slice of nature to go camping with all of the amenities you need. This state park takes up 1,900 acres of Massachusetts beauty and has 400 different campsites to choose from, so you'll never feel too close to your fellow visitors. From sites with RV hookups, to classic campsites, and even yurt camping, there's something here to make your camping trip perfect. Welcome to Nickerson State Park!
This 1,900-acre state park in Brewster is one of the largest state parks in Massachusetts, and is home to some of the most stunning pieces of nature.
Nickerson State Parks' campground has become one of the most popular spots for an outdoor adventure, as there are 400 different campsites. Since this park is so large, you'll never feel too close to your other visitors.
This state park is full of dozens of outdoor activities, so you'll never run out of things to do during your Brewster camping adventure. You may even find relics from the past, such as glacial boulders throughout the park.
Home to ponds and beaches, this is a great spot to take a dip, go fishing, paddle boarding, or boating. Just a short walk from your campsite and you'll emerge into some of Cape Cod's most beautiful atmospheres.
There are also plenty of hiking trails within Nickerson State Park, so grab your boots or a bike and explore these 1,900 acres.
Since there are so many campsites to choose from, there are many different options. From a hook-up site to a yurt in the woods, there are many options for the perfect camping trip.
